im excited--i ordered the big kit and i guess there should be 4 quick shakes in it. i use my quick shake containers every single day for something. i have 2 and could definitely use more haha. actually this past week at work, i was eating pudding from one for two days LOL. easy stuff--i put 2 cups of milk and a pkg of instant pudding mix (yes it was heaped over the top) then put the domed lid on carefully and sealed and shook for a couple of minutes and put in the fridge the night before. i took it to work and had no hassle pudding that i ate for dessert with my lunch - half one day and half the next. ive done this with jello and i also use them a lot to put homemade smoothies in to take to work.
